Output df68db845e7f762be771856ca5c68b6dc7fcdeafb9f05a51eeefb5dc4ab725ce:41

value
532384
script pubkey
OP_0 OP_PUSHBYTES_20 b871aeedc1695b4bc39b800f3fd860093a387eaf
address
bc1qhpc6amwpd9d5hsumsq8nlkrqpyarsl400kzj3s
transaction
df68db845e7f762be771856ca5c68b6dc7fcdeafb9f05a51eeefb5dc4ab725ce
confirmations
57027
spent
true